Abstract

This report is a reflection of the learning and experiences acquired through an opportunity to be associated with Robi Axiata Ltd. for an internship under the Market Operations department. This department is made up of many sub-departments; however, this report focuses on the ones that were closely observed. The three main sub-departments were the Dhonnobad Program, Campaign, and International Roaming. The major responsibilities associated with this particular job title comprised of working on partnership management (managing contracts and promotions), managing events, data analysis and interpretation for high-value customers and creating reports on the progress of the different aspects of the Dhonnobad Program.This report contains the analysis of different loyalty program for high-value customers in Bangladesh telecom industry.For retaining the high-value customers Robi and other telecom companies have taken different types of loyalty program like a reward, discount, and win back.Among these companies the strategies for dealing with different segment of loyal customers and high-value customers is different.Robi Grameen phone Bangla link and other telecom companies of Bangladesh are following different steps to delight these high-end customers. So, I decided to do the project on ―Analysis of different loyalty program of Bangladesh telecom industry‖
